About HTTPie

HTTPie is a modern API testing client designed to make working with APIs simple and intuitive for developers. Originally created as a command-line tool to replace curl with a more human-friendly interface, HTTPie has evolved into a comprehensive platform offering both terminal and desktop applications. The tool is trusted by developers at major technology companies worldwide and has garnered significant community support with nearly 48,000 GitHub stars.

  • User-Friendly CLI - The terminal version provides an intuitive command-line interface with syntax highlighting, JSON support, and a clean output format that makes API testing more efficient than traditional tools like curl.

  • Desktop Application - HTTPie for Web & Desktop wraps the power of the terminal version in a sleek graphical interface, making API testing accessible to developers who prefer visual tools.

  • AI Integration - HTTPie incorporates state-of-the-art artificial intelligence to enhance the API development workflow and assist developers throughout the API lifecycle.

  • Cross-Platform Support - Available on multiple platforms including Linux, macOS, and Windows, with installation options through snap, apt, brew, choco, pip, port, yum, and more package managers.

  • Export/Import Functionality - Recent updates include the ability to export and import configurations, path parameters support, and copy as command features for improved workflow.

  • Open Source Foundation - The CLI tool is open source, allowing developers to contribute, customize, and extend the functionality according to their needs.

  • Collaborative Features - Building toward a collaborative platform for API development, HTTPie focuses on places where humans and APIs intersect.

To get started with HTTPie, developers can install the CLI through their preferred package manager or download the desktop application. The terminal version supports intuitive syntax like http GET https://api.example.com with automatic JSON formatting and syntax coloring. The desktop app provides a visual interface for constructing and testing API requests without memorizing command-line syntax.

Developer

HTTPie, Inc.

HTTPie, Inc. builds API testing tools that make working with APIs simple and intuitive for developers. Founded by Jakub Roztocil, the company started with an open-source CLI tool that became one of the top projects on GitHub with nearly 48,000 stars. HTTPie has raised a $6.5M Seed Round from Coatue, Blossom Capital, and founders of Intercom, Checkout.com, and Monzo. The company is headquartered in San Francisco and is building a collaborative platform for API development using state-of-the-art AI.
